Hello, Morgan County! My name is Katie Roth, and I am excited to introduce myself as the newest Multimedia Reporter at The Fort Morgan Times and Brush News-Tribune. I just moved across the country from my home state of Georgia to help share local news stories in this community.

I discovered my passion for storytelling in high school and knew I wanted to pursue a career where my writing and photography skills would be well used.

When deciding which college to attend, I was torn between Colorado State University and Samford University. I ended up choosing the smaller journalism program in Birmingham, Alabama, with hopes I would have more opportunities to get involved in student publications and local internships. I focused my studies on print journalism and photography and spent all four years working on the yearbook staff as a writer, photographer and in editorial positions. I graduated in May 2020 with a bachelor’s degree in journalism and mass communications and a minor in design and communications.

I read about The Fort Morgan Times position and knew I couldn’t turn down another chance to move to Colorado. While I don’t have any personal ties to Fort Morgan itself, my love for Colorado runs deep. I have spent time skiing in Aspen and staying with family in Fort Collins. During the summer of 2016, I even worked on a Fort Collins based food truck called mac’n!

I am always up for a spontaneous new adventure and am looking forward to exploring Morgan County and meeting its residents. I can be reached at kroth@fortmorgantimes.com.
